About John Maclaurin, Lord Dreghorn

Biographical Summary

Maclaurin, Lord Dreghorn, John. 15/12/1734-24/12/1796. Ref: 1011. Male.

  • Titles and British Honours: Hon.
  • Place of Birth: Edinburgh.
  • Place of Death: Edinburgh.
  • Place of interment: Greyfriars Cemy, Edinburgh.
  • Profession: Advocate.
  • Appointments Held: Advocate 1756; Private legal practice; Senator of the College of Justice 1788-96.
  • Schools and Tutors: High School, Edinburgh 1745-7.
  • Undergraduate Studies: Edinburgh University.
  • Publications: "The Philosopher's Opera" 1757, "Obervations on some points of Law with a System of the Juridical Law of Moses; Essays in Verse" 1769, "Arguments and Decisions in the High Court" 1774.
  • Marital Status: Married (1762) Esther Cunningham d.1780.
  • Mother: Anne Stewart.
  • Father: Colin Maclaurin 1698-1746 Professor of Mathematics.
  • References: DNB 35, 1893, 198-9; F J Grant 1944; Anderson 3, 38; Shapin 315; S Devlin-Thorp Scotland's Cultural Heritage, 2, 1981, 59; W P Anderson 1931, 394.
  • Memberships: Highland Society (Director).
  • Date of Election: 17/11/1783.
  • Proposers: Founder Member.
  • Service to the RSE: Councillor 1789-96.
  • Fellow Type: OF.

SOURCE: Waterston, Charles D; Macmillan Shearer, A (July 2006). Biographical index of former fellows of the Royal Society of Edinburgh, 1783-2002: Biographical Index. II. Edinburgh: The Royal Society of Edinburgh. ISBN 978-0-902198-84-5. page 602
